In a time when faith and entertainment intertwined, "The Old Miracle Plays of England" by Netta Syrett unveils the captivating realm of medieval religious theater. These plays, rich in symbolism and morality, served as a vital medium for storytelling, reflecting societal values and spiritual beliefs. Syrett meticulously explores the origins and evolution of these performances, highlighting their role in shaping community identity and religious expression. Ideal for students and historians alike, this work provides a comprehensive analysis of the unique elements of miracle plays, including their use of allegory and the integration of local culture. Discover how these theatrical masterpieces not only entertained but also educated audiences, leaving a lasting legacy on English literature and drama.
